Map the System is a global competition that asks students and educators to rethink social and environmental issues through systems thinking — going beyond disciplines and questioning deeply held assumptions.

Join the Economic Trust of the Southern Interior for an info session on Map the System 2026.

Date: Wednesday, Jan. 14, 2026

Time: 11 a.m. – noon

Location: OLARA 2nd floor, Research Hub

This session will provide an overview of the competition, key deadlines, participation requirements and available supports at TRU.

Whether you are new to systems thinking or looking to develop a project idea, this session will help you understand how to get involved, set yourself up for success and get entered for a chance to win a trip to Oxford this summer!
